NAC 444.300  Notice of violation. (NRS 439.200, 444.070)  If the health authority inspects a public bathing or swimming facility or natural bathing place and finds a violation of any provision of NAC 444.010 to 444.306, inclusive, that does not seriously endanger the public health, the health authority shall issue a written notice of the violation to the owner or his or her representative and allow a reasonable time for the violation to be corrected.

    Reinspection

    NAC 444.306  Reinspection. (NRS 439.200, 444.070, 444.100)

    1.  After the specified corrective action has been taken, the owner or operator or his or her representative shall notify the health authority that the facility or bathing place is ready for reinspection.

    2.  If upon reinspection the corrective action is approved, the health authority shall order the reinstatement of the operating permit, at which time the facility or bathing place may be opened for use.

    3.  If upon reinspection the corrective action is not approved, the operating permit remains suspended and the facility or bathing place must be kept closed and out of use until corrective action is approved.
